Oct. 15th, 2009 09:01 pmIn about an hour and a half tonight I've mostly constructed my knockoff scoundrelle underbust-corset-dress.
This pattern, gotten for $.99

Without the bodice part it's basically a high-waisted princess-seamed skirt. I shortened it to just-past-knee-length, re-shaped the top edge, and then made a boned "facing" that is turned, topstitched, and then stitched-in-the-ditch along the seamlines to keep it in place. It's zoing to zip up the side, and with the addition of a grosgrain waist stay it should work properly.
It's in a plain navy blue "mystery fabric". I wanted something with a suitable silhouette as a base for the Adventuress outfit I'm building. Basically, I wanted an excuse to wear my ray-gun, and I'm modding up a Crafstman My First Engine kit

as hopefully a Backpack Time Machine. I repainted it over the weekend - the red plastic part is now a hammered black/bronze, the radiators are a matte silver distressed with some "grease" aka black liquid shoe polish, and the various molded bits are suitable painted.
